Web30 de jan. de 2024 · Chromosomes and DNA. Your body is made of cells that contain your genetic information, or DNA. DNA gives instructions to your body to develop and function, and it makes you who you are. DNA is organized in our cells into long pieces called chromosomes. Image by K. Fryer. WebYou have 23 pairs of chromosomes. One chromosome in each pair was inherited from your mother and the other from your father. While the chromosomes are tightly twisted in the cell’s nucleus at a microscopic level, if you were to lay them straight against each other, each pair could be arranged from the longest to shortest and numbered 1–23.
